Solving polynomial equations by factoring Solve: 1/2x^2+5x+25/2=0 Full explanation please, thanks

Answer:

x=-5

Explanation:

1/2x^2+5x+25/2=0

Multiply each side by 2 to clear the fractions

2*(1/2x^2+5x+25/2)=0*2

Distribute

x^2+10x+25=0

What two numbers multiply together to give us 25 and add together to give us 10

5*5 = 25

5+5 =10

(x+5) (x+5) =0

Using the zero product property

x+5 =0 x+5 = 0

x+5-5= 0-5 x+5-5 =0-5

x=-5 x=-5

x=-5
